Item 5.02 Departure of Directors or Certain Officers; Election of Directors; Appointment of Certain Officers; Compensatory Arrangements of Certain Officers.

(b) Information regarding changes in roles and responsibilities of Eric Ford and Charles L. Meintjes is incorporated herein by reference from Item 5.02(c) below.

(c) On October 23, 2012, Peabody Energy Corporation ("Peabody") announced leadership changes within the business units to further strengthen Peabody’s global operating platform. Peabody has named Eric Ford as Chairman of Peabody’s Australia Business Unit, Charles L. Meintjes as President – Australia and Kemal Williamson as President – Americas. Mr. Ford currently serves as President – Australia and Mr. Meintjes currently serves as Acting President – Americas. All changes are effective November 15, 2012.

In his new role as Chairman of Peabody’s Australia Business Unit, Mr. Ford will oversee strategic direction, operational and commercial strategy and performance, and external stakeholder interaction. Mr. Ford, age 58, joined Peabody in March 2007 as Executive Vice President and Chief Operating Officer, and served in that position until he was named President – Australia in March 2012. He has over 40 years of extensive international management, operating and engineering experience. Mr. Ford serves on the board of directors of Compass Minerals International, Inc.

In his new role as President – Australia, Mr. Meintjes will lead business unit teams that manage all aspects of the Australia operating platform with responsibility for health and safety, operations, sales and marketing, product delivery and support functions. Mr. Meintjes, age 49, has extensive operational, strategy, continuous improvement and information technology experience with mining companies on three continents. He joined Peabody in 2007, and most recently served as Acting President – Americas and Group Executive of Operations for the Midwest and Colorado. Other past positions with Peabody include Senior Vice President of Operations Improvement and Senior Vice President Engineering and Continuous Improvement.

In his new role as President – Americas, Mr. Williamson will lead business unit teams that manage all aspects of the Americas operating platform with responsibility for health and safety, operations, sales and marketing, product delivery and support functions. Mr. Williamson, age 53, brings more than 30 years experience in mining engineering and operations roles across North America and Australia. He joined Peabody in 2000, and most recently was Group Executive Operations for the Peabody Energy Australia operations. Other past positions with Peabody include Group Executive – Powder River Basin Operations, Group Executive – Midwest Operations, and Director – Land Management.

Peabody intends to enter into amended employment agreements with Messrs. Meintjes and Williamson on or about November 15, 2012, and will file an amendment to this Current Report on Form 8-K to provide a brief description of those agreements.
